The Rise of Animated Films in Box Office Rankings

Animated films have steadily gained ground in box office rankings, often outperforming live-action films. Here are a few reasons behind this trend:

  • Universal Appeal: Animated films can attract audiences of all ages, making them a go-to choice for family outings.
  • Strong Merchandising: The Toy Story brand is synonymous with toys and merchandise, which contributes to its box office draw.
  • Positive Word of Mouth: Previous successes create anticipation and excitement, leading to increased ticket sales.
